    Este registo pertence ao Repositório Científico do LNECThe railway track continually degrades over its life cycle. This has negative consequences for maintenance and availability of the lines and is particularly evident at locations with abrupt changes in the track’s support conditions, such as transition zones to bridges or other structures. To mitigate this problem, modern lines comprise specifically designed backfills with high-performance geomaterials to provide an adequate approach to the structures. However, the problem of track degradation at transition zones is far from being completely solved. The research presented in this Thesis aimed at providing insight into the structural behaviour of transition zones using a novel and integrated approach to investigate the problem, contributing to an efficient management of railway assets, in the context of the life-cycle cost reduction paradigm of the railway system, in particular, the railway track. In the scope of a research project involving LNEC, FEUP and REFER, a 30 km-long railway line is used as case study and its construction is followed up closely. Laboratorial characterisation of bound and unbound granular material used in transition zones is carried out, in particular using cyclic load triaxial tests on large specimens. Thorough in situ characterisation of the track substructure is performed, including specific portancemètre surveys at transition zones. The deformation of the backfill of a transition zone case study to a bridge is monitored using different techniques, including sub-horizontal inclinometers installed during construction. The results obtained regarding the substructure at transition zones indicate that the design of the backfills was successful in minimizing settlements and achieving a gradual stiffness increase at the approach to the structures. The analysis of the evolution of the geometric quality of the line evidenced higher degradation rates at some transition zones and other track singularities, mostly associated with abrupt changes in the track substructure. To fill the gap between experimental and numerical studies, extensive field measurements are presented and used to calibrate and validate FEM models that consider the relevant track components of the superstructure and substructure. The models also account for the dynamic train-track interaction and are very accurate in reproducing the measurements. The experimental works comprised dynamic track characterisation with receptance tests and a new approach using the light falling weight deflectometer. Innovative solutions for transition zones, such as under sleeper pads (USP), are also analysed in detail in specific case studies of transition zones to underpasses. The experimental results evidenced the increase in the vertical stiffness of the track at the approach to structures, which could suggest the amplification of the dynamic track-interaction. However, because the design of the backfills provides a smooth stiffness variation and the track evidenced a very good track quality, the simulations indicated limited dynamic amplifications of the train loads in the tested scenarios. As regards USP, simulations suggested a beneficial contribution to reduce track degradation rates, but a careful design is required to prevent excessive dynamic amplifications when trains enter or exit sections of the track with USP. Later, the effect of the differential settlements on the dynamic response of the train-track system at the approach to structures is investigated. To that aim, comprehensive parametric studies using numerical simulations are carried out. The results of the simulations are integrated and used to establish performance indicators that affect the train-track interaction, based on the length and amplitude of track defects. A novel approach is then presented and applied to the line under study, in an attempt to associate the results of the parametric studies with locations denoting rapid track degradation or other critical scenarios.     This paper presents the principles of a method for the architectural design of timber houses based on the experience gained by timber companies. This proposal has as its major goal the challenging of the scenario of countries like Portugal where a shift in the design and construction methods integrating wood as a material could result in a much more sustainable habitat. A set of interviews was carried out with Portuguese companies in the sector of timber houses. They were questioned about their customers, design methods, the architect’s role and the choice of structural systems. Based on the interviews it was possible to characterize the market and identify the main procedures about design. The most relevant ones were the importance of the architectural type definition, the support of a catalog, the relationship between formal and structural types and the architect’s lack of knowledge about timber. The collected information pointed to an architectural design method to be used by Portuguese architects who, until now have often played a secondary role when a timber house was designed partly because the timber companies dominate the whole process. Some of these companies offer catalogues of design solutions that support customer’s choices. The architects generally reject this type of method because of its supposed uncreative and impersonal results. The method here presented through some basic principles aims at collecting some positive lessons from the catalogue method, defining a process based on the recognition of Formal types and Construction types.     Apresentam-se os aspetos relevantes da análise e interpretação do comportamento observado da barragem de Rebordelo, no rio Rabaçal, em Trás-os-Montes, durante o primeiro enchimento controlado da albufeira, ocorrido no início de 2005, e nos primeiros anos de exploração, com base na observação das ações e das respostas, bem como na utilização de modelos matemáticos para resolução dos problemas térmico e estrutural. Nas análises térmica e estrutural consideraram-se: i) um modelo tridimensional da barragem e do maciço rochoso de fundação, resolvido pelo método dos elementos finitos; ii) o comportamento viscoelástico do betão; e iii) a variação das ações da água sobre o paramento de montante e das ações térmicas no corpo da barragem.     Hoje em dia é praticamente consensual no seio da comunidade científica que a insuficiência da espessura do betão de recobrimento é uma das principais causas de deterioração prematura das estruturas de betão armado por corrosão das armaduras. Contudo, a maioria das normas de execução que lidam com questões de durabilidade não fornecem indicações para uma adequada inspeção e controlo da conformidade da espessura do betão de recobrimento nas obras. Para tal, foi desenvolvido pelo comité técnico da RILEM TC 230-PSC Performance-based specifications and control of concrete durability, um documento técnico com um conjunto de linhas orientadoras e regras para a inspeção da espessura do betão de recobrimento, adaptadas ao tipo de estrutura a inspecionar.     The research reported in this paper is part of the R&D project COST-TRENDs, funded by the Portuguese Foundation for Science and Technology. It presents a strategic assessment study of the hinterland connections centred in the Port of Sines, in Portugal, that integrates the core network corridor of the Trans-European Transport Network (TEN-T) designated as the Atlantic corridor. The study comprised the analysis of trends of maritime freight costs until 2020 and the assessment of alternative intermodal freight transport options to reduce costs along the multimodal transport chains. The options evaluated focused in the Iberian section of the Atlantic corridor and included the combination of maritime-short sea shipping, maritime-rail, maritime-road and, also, rail-air modes.
